Transaction 95b86907093cd62aa4334dc2ff0d32c11807d13b6dc265a1306e211933703d21
1 Input
1 Outputs
- 95b86907093cd62aa4334dc2ff0d32c11807d13b6dc265a1306e211933703d21:0
value 9992645
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u